New Frontiers in Assessment Monitoring & Evaluation  -- What You Need to Know About New DoD Requirements
A DoD Policy directive issued in 2017 established policy and assigned responsibilities for conducting assessment, monitoring and evaluation (AM&E) in the area of security cooperation. The policy directive calls for collaborative evaluations across DoD components as well as with other USG Agencies and international partners to facilitate mutual learning and reduce cost.
